Our take

Where Azure API Management leads

  • Stronger evidenced coverage on 23 of the 29 capabilities where they differ (led by multi-protocol support and waf / owasp api top 10 protection).
  • Stated SAP integration the alternative doesn't list.

Where Red Hat 3scale API Management leads

  • Stronger evidenced coverage on 6 of the 29 capabilities where they differ (led by self-service developer portal and app registration & subscriptions).

Azure API Management vs Red Hat 3scale API Management — FAQs

Is Azure API Management or Red Hat 3scale API Management better for ERP integration?

They state different ERP coverage: Azure API Management lists SAP; Red Hat 3scale API Management lists no ERP integrations publicly.
